Uncovering Hidden Climate Clues

Researchers have used historical diaries to estimate sunlight levels in 18th and 19th century Tokyo, shedding new light on the city's climate history. The study focused on the Ishikawa Diaries, written between 1720 and 1875.

The diaries, kept by samurai-class individuals, contained weather records that allowed scientists to reconstruct daily solar radiation levels. By analyzing these records, the team gained insight into Tokyo's climate during the Edo period.

Can Historical Records Improve Climate Models?

The researchers developed a method to quantify solar radiation from the diary entries, which included descriptions of weather conditions. They compared their estimates with modern-day measurements from the Japan Meteorological Agency Tokyo Observatory. The results showed that the historical diaries provided a reliable record of sunlight levels, with some variations due to volcanic eruptions and other factors.

The study's findings have significant implications for climate modeling. By incorporating historical data, researchers can improve the accuracy of climate models and better understand long-term climate trends. The team plans to expand their research to other regions and time periods, further enriching our understanding of the past climate.
